Can Chiropractic Care Help with Indigestion?

Indigestion is a common complaint that can leave people feeling uncomfortable, bloated, and frustrated. Symptoms such as stomach discomfort, bloating, heartburn, and nausea can affect daily life and make it difficult to enjoy meals. While dietary changes and medical treatments are often the primary approaches for managing digestive issues, some people wonder whether chiropractic care may also play a supportive role.

Understanding the Connection Between the Spine and the Nervous System

The nervous system plays an important role in regulating many functions throughout the body, including digestion. Nerves that originate in the spine help communicate signals between the brain and the digestive organs. When spinal joints become restricted or dysfunctional, it may contribute to discomfort, tension, and altered nervous system function.

Chiropractors focus on improving spinal mobility and supporting the body’s overall function through gentle adjustments and other therapeutic techniques.

How Chiropractic Care May Support Digestive Health

While chiropractic treatment is not a cure for indigestion, some patients report improvements in their overall well-being and digestive comfort after receiving care. Potential benefits may include:

Reduced Physical Stress

Stress can have a significant impact on digestion. Chiropractic adjustments may help reduce muscle tension and promote relaxation, which can support healthy digestive function.

Improved Posture

Poor posture, especially when sitting for long periods, can place pressure on the abdomen and contribute to discomfort after meals. Chiropractic care often includes posture assessment and recommendations to help improve alignment.

Better Mobility and Comfort

Spinal restrictions can contribute to general discomfort and tension throughout the body. Improving mobility may help patients feel more comfortable and active, supporting overall health and wellness.

A Whole-Body Approach

Many chiropractors take a holistic approach to health and may provide guidance on lifestyle factors that influence digestion, including:

  • Healthy eating habits
  • Hydration
  • Exercise and movement
  • Stress management
  • Ergonomic and posture improvements

These factors can all contribute to better digestive health and overall wellness.

When to Seek Medical Advice

Persistent indigestion, severe abdominal pain, unexplained weight loss, difficulty swallowing, or ongoing digestive symptoms should always be evaluated by a medical professional. These symptoms may indicate an underlying condition that requires medical diagnosis and treatment.
